Title :
A quasi-passive modulation circuit improving the current waveform of conventional rectifiers

Abstract :
This paper proposes a new auxiliary modulation circuit to be retrofitted to an existing conventional AC/DC converter to improve line current waveform. The auxiliary circuit modulates the rectifier´s DC side current at triple line-frequency and injects a calculated amount of third harmonic current back into its AC side. This circuit takes advantage of DC ripple voltage to generate the modulation current. It consists of mainly passive components and can be easily retrofitted to existing rectifiers. Theoretical analysis, digital simulation results and experimental verification on a 12.5 kW prototype have been presented in this paper
